新聞中心
在C語言中,表達(dá)式i > 5是一個關(guān)系表達(dá)式,它用于比較變量i的值是否大于5,如果i的值確實大于5,那么這個表達(dá)式的結(jié)果為真(true),否則為假(false)。

創(chuàng)新互聯(lián)專注于定州企業(yè)網(wǎng)站建設(shè),響應(yīng)式網(wǎng)站,商城開發(fā)。定州網(wǎng)站建設(shè)公司,為定州等地區(qū)提供建站服務(wù)。全流程定制制作,專業(yè)設(shè)計,全程項目跟蹤,創(chuàng)新互聯(lián)專業(yè)和態(tài)度為您提供的服務(wù)
為了更好地理解這個表達(dá)式,我們可以從以下幾個小標(biāo)題進行詳細(xì)解釋:
1. 關(guān)系運算符
C語言提供了關(guān)系運算符來比較兩個值之間的關(guān)系。>是關(guān)系運算符之一,用于判斷左側(cè)操作數(shù)是否大于右側(cè)操作數(shù)。
2. 表達(dá)式求值
當(dāng)C語言的編譯器遇到一個表達(dá)式時,它會計算該表達(dá)式的值,對于i > 5,它會檢查變量i的值是否大于5,并返回一個布爾值(在C語言中通常用1表示真,0表示假)。
3. 變量i
在表達(dá)式i > 5中,i是一個變量,它的值在表達(dá)式被求值之前必須是已知的,如果i沒有被初始化或者賦值,那么它的值是未定義的,這可能導(dǎo)致不可預(yù)測的結(jié)果。
4. 使用場景
這種類型的表達(dá)式通常用在條件語句中,例如if語句。if (i > 5) { /* 一些代碼 */ },如果i的值大于5,那么括號內(nèi)的代碼塊將被執(zhí)行。
5. 注意事項
在使用關(guān)系表達(dá)式時,需要注意以下幾點:
確保變量在使用之前已經(jīng)被正確初始化或賦值。
關(guān)系表達(dá)式的結(jié)果是一個布爾值,但在C語言中,這個布爾值會被當(dāng)作整數(shù)處理。
在復(fù)雜的表達(dá)式中,注意運算符的優(yōu)先級,必要時可以使用括號來明確計算順序。
i > 5是C語言中一個非?;A(chǔ)的關(guān)系表達(dá)式,用于判斷變量i的值是否大于5,了解這一點對于編寫正確的條件語句和循環(huán)結(jié)構(gòu)至關(guān)重要。
網(wǎng)站名稱:c語言i>5到底怎么回事
網(wǎng)站地址:http://www.5511xx.com/article/dhgppdd.html


咨詢
建站咨詢
